Responsibilities

  • Maintains attorneys' calendars.
  • Schedules court appearances, client meetings, depositions, and other engagements. Ensures there are no scheduling conflicts and notifies attorneys of pending deadlines.
  • Serves as intermediary between attorneys, firm personnel and the courts, relaying communications between each group.
  • Generates all correspondence.
  • Prepares and sends notices of filings, motions, and hearing to appropriate parties.
  • Creates and maintains client files, records, logs, and any other information in relation to case file.
  • Prepares and sends file correspondence to clients weekly with filings and status updates.
  • Finalizes and files/serves all Court pleadings and discovery.
  • Works with paralegals to ensure experts are retained and receive necessary documents.
